Cheesy Taco Pasta

A quick and easy ground beef and pasta dish with taco seasoning and cheese, perfect for weeknights.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 6 servings
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: American

Ingredients
  

For the Taco Pasta
  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 packet taco seasoning from the grocery store
  • 1 cup water
  • 1 can diced tomatoes undrained, 14.5 ounces
  • 2 cups uncooked pasta such as rotini or penne
  • 1.5 cups shredded cheese cheddar or Mexican blend

Equipment

  • Large skillet
  • Colander

Method
 

  1. Brown the ground beef in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Drain off any excess grease.
  2. Stir in the taco seasoning and water. Bring to a simmer.
  3. Add the diced tomatoes and uncooked pasta to the skillet. Stir to combine.
  4. Cover the skillet and reduce heat to medium-low. Cook for 15-20 minutes, or until the pasta is tender, stirring occasionally.
  5. Remove from heat and stir in the shredded cheese until melted and combined.
  6. Serve hot.

Notes

You can add toppings like sour cream, salsa, or chopped cilantro if desired.
